In this grounded, real-world conversation, Danny sits down with healthcare leader Donna McNichol to explore what leadership actually looks like on the front lines. Drawing from decades of experience managing complex healthcare teams, Donna shares why great leadership isn’t about constant firefighting—it’s about building systems that prevent emergencies before they happen.
Together, they unpack the hidden cost of “fire hose management,” how workplace drama quietly drains energy, and why boredom can actually be a sign of healthy leadership. This episode is a must-listen for managers who want stability, trust, and momentum—especially in high-pressure environments like healthcare.
Key Takeaways:
- Constant emergency management is exhausting—and often preventable with better systems
- Strong leaders reduce drama by addressing issues early and directly
- Psychological safety grows when mistakes are treated as system issues, not personal failures
- Preventative leadership creates space for focus, energy, and even fun at work
- Culture is shaped through small, consistent behaviors—not big dramatic moves
